Crunchy Thai Chickpea Salad – A Fresh & Flavorful Plant-Based Delight!

Crunchy Thai Chickpea Salad: A Fresh, Flavor-Packed Delight! 🥗🌿

Looking for a healthy, vibrant, and delicious salad that comes together in minutes? This Crunchy Thai Chickpea Salad is bursting with bold flavors, fresh veggies, and plant-based protein. It’s the perfect light meal, meal-prep option, or side dish that’s both refreshing and satisfying.

The combination of crunchy vegetables, creamy peanut dressing, and protein-rich chickpeas makes this salad an energizing and nutrient-packed choice. Whether you’re vegan, vegetarian, or just love fresh flavors, this recipe is a must-try!


Why You’ll Love This Recipe

✔ Quick & Easy – Ready in 10 minutes, no cooking required!
✔ Packed with Plant-Based Protein – Chickpeas make this salad filling & nutritious.
✔ Crunchy, Creamy & Flavorful – The peanut dressing ties it all together beautifully.
✔ Great for Meal Prep – Make a batch and enjoy it for lunch all week long!


Ingredients You’ll Need

(Serves 4 | Prep Time: 10 minutes)

  • 1 (15 oz) can chickpeas, drained and rinsed
  • 1 cup shredded carrots
  • 1 red bell pepper, diced
  • 1/2 cup chopped cilantro
  • 1/4 cup chopped green onions
  • 1/4 cup peanut dressing (store-bought or homemade)
  • 1 tablespoon lime juice
  • Salt & pepper, to taste

👉 Optional Add-Ins for Extra Flavor:
✔ 1/4 cup chopped peanuts – Adds a crunchy bite.
✔ 1 teaspoon sesame seeds – A nutty, toasty touch.
✔ 1 teaspoon sriracha or chili flakes – For a spicy kick!
✔ 1/2 cup shredded purple cabbage – For even more color and texture.


How to Make Crunchy Thai Chickpea Salad

1. Prep the Chickpeas

  • Drain and rinse canned chickpeas, then add them to a large mixing bowl.

2. Add the Fresh Veggies

  • Toss in the shredded carrots, diced red bell pepper, chopped cilantro, and green onions.

3. Make the Dressing

  • In a small bowl, whisk together:
    ✔ Peanut dressing
    ✔ Fresh lime juice
    ✔ (Optional) A pinch of chili flakes for heat

4. Combine & Toss

  • Pour the dressing over the chickpea and veggie mixture.
  • Mix gently until everything is evenly coated.

5. Season & Serve

  • Add salt and pepper to taste.
  • Enjoy immediately, or refrigerate for 30 minutes for even better flavor!

💡 Tip: This salad tastes even better the next day as the flavors meld together!


Pro Tips for the Best Thai Chickpea Salad

✔ Use Fresh Ingredients – Crisp veggies give this salad its signature crunch.
✔ Customize the Dressing – Make it sweeter, spicier, or tangier based on your taste.
✔ Chill Before Serving – For a more refreshing, infused flavor, refrigerate for 30 minutes.
✔ Double the Recipe – This salad stores well for meal prep!


Fun Variations to Try

🥑 Creamy Thai Chickpea Salad – Add diced avocado for a rich, creamy texture.
🥜 Crunchy Peanut Thai Salad – Stir in chopped peanuts for extra crunch.
🍜 Chickpea Noodle Salad – Mix in cold rice noodles for a hearty twist.
🔥 Spicy Thai Chickpea Salad – Add extra sriracha or Thai chili paste.


What to Serve with Thai Chickpea Salad

This refreshing, protein-packed salad pairs perfectly with:

🍛 Grilled Chicken or Tofu – Adds extra protein and heartiness.
🍚 Steamed Jasmine Rice or Quinoa – A filling side option.
🥤 Thai Iced Tea or Coconut Water – A cooling beverage pairing.
🍜 Spring Rolls or Dumplings – A complete Thai-inspired meal!


FAQs About Thai Chickpea Salad

Q: Can I make this salad ahead of time?
A: Yes! Store it in an airtight container in the fridge for up to 3 days.

Q: How do I make homemade peanut dressing?
A: Mix together:

  • 1/4 cup peanut butter
  • 2 tablespoons soy sauce
  • 1 tablespoon lime juice
  • 1 tablespoon honey or maple syrup
  • 1 teaspoon sesame oil
  • 1-2 tablespoons warm water to thin it out

Q: Can I use dried chickpeas instead of canned?
A: Yes! Soak, cook, and cool dried chickpeas before using them in this salad.

Q: How do I store leftovers?
A: Keep in the fridge for up to 3 days—just give it a stir before serving.


A Light, Refreshing, and Flavorful Meal!

This Crunchy Thai Chickpea Salad is fresh, nutritious, and loaded with bold flavors. Whether you serve it as a side dish, meal prep lunch, or quick dinner, it’s guaranteed to satisfy.

Try it out and let me know—what’s your favorite way to enjoy chickpeas? Drop a comment and share your thoughts! 🥗🌿✨

Crunchy Thai Chickpea Salad – A Fresh & Flavorful Plant-Based Delight!

Crunchy Thai Chickpea Salad – A Fresh & Flavorful Plant-Based Delight!

Looking for a healthy, vibrant, and delicious salad that comes together in minutes? This Crunchy Thai Chickpea Salad is bursting with bold flavors, fresh veggies, and plant-based protein. It’s the perfect light meal, meal-prep option, or side dish that’s both refreshing and satisfying.
By Jason GriffithPublished on March 15, 2025
Prep Time10 min
Cook Time30 min
Total Time45 min
Servings4 servings
Category: Salad
Cuisine: Thai

Ingredients

  • 4 cups chopped peanuts
  • 1 teaspoon sesame seeds
  • 1 teaspoon sriracha or chili flakes
  • 2 cups shredded purple cabbage
  • 1 cup cooked chickpeas
  • 1/4 cup peanut butter
  • 1 tablespoon lime juice
  • 1 tablespoon honey or maple syrup
  • 1 teaspoon sesame oil
  • 1/4 cup chopped cilantro
  • Salt to taste

Instructions

  1. In a large bowl, combine the shredded purple cabbage and cooked chickpeas.
  2. In a separate small bowl, whisk together peanut butter, lime juice, honey or maple syrup, sesame oil, sriracha, and salt until smooth.
  3. Pour the dressing over the cabbage and chickpeas and toss to combine.
  4. Add chopped peanuts, sesame seeds, and cilantro to the salad, and mix well.
  5. Serve immediately, or chill in the refrigerator for 30 minutes before serving for enhanced flavors.

Nutrition Information

@type: NutritionInformation
Calories: 350 calories
Protein Content: 12g
Carbohydrate Content: 40g
Fat Content: 18g
Tags: salad, Thai salad, chickpea salad, plant-based, healthy recipes, vegan, meal prep